数控编程ao是什么

fiy 其他 8

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    数控编程(AO)是一种通过计算机指令和代码来控制数控机床运动的技术。它将设计师或操作者的指令转换为机器能够理解和执行的指令,从而实现对机床的精确控制和加工。

    首先,数控编程是为了替代传统手工操作的一种新技术。在传统的机床操作过程中,操作者需要根据图纸和测量数据进行手工操作,这种方式容易出现误差,并且效率较低。而数控编程则通过计算机编写好的程序来控制机床,大大提高了加工的精度和效率。

    其次,数控编程使用一种特定的编程语言来描述加工工艺和机床运动轨迹。常用的数控编程语言包括G代码和M代码。G代码用于描述机床的运动轨迹,比如直线、圆弧等;M代码用于描述机床的辅助功能,如开关、停止等。通过合理编写这些代码,可以实现复杂的加工操作。

    然后,数控编程还包括对机床的参数设置和刀具路径规划等内容。在进行数控编程时,需要考虑机床的型号和规格,以及所使用的刀具和材料等因素。通过合理设置这些参数,可以保证加工的质量和效率。

    综上所述,数控编程是一种通过计算机指令和代码来控制数控机床运动的技术。它可以大大提高加工的精度和效率,是现代制造业中不可或缺的重要技术。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    数控编程(Computer Numerical Control Programming,简称CNC编程)是一种通过编写指令来控制数控机床运动和加工工件的技术。它是将人们设计的产品和工程图纸转化为一系列能够被数控机床识别和执行的指令代码的过程。以下是关于数控编程的五个要点:

    1. 数控编程的基本原理:数控编程是一种将加工过程转化为数值控制命令的技术。通过编写程序代码,可实现诸如刀具移动、进给速度、切削深度等加工参数的控制,从而实现精确的加工操作。

    2. 数控编程的语言:数控编程使用的主要语言是G代码和M代码。G代码用于描述刀具的轨迹、速度、进给等运动参数,而M代码则用于描述机床的辅助功能,如冷却液的开关、主轴的启停等。这些代码可以通过专门的数控编程软件编写,并由数控系统解析和执行。

    3. 数控编程的工作流程:数控编程的工作流程包括产品设计、工程图纸绘制、数控编程软件编写代码、代码调试和生成机床可执行的指令文件。在编写代码过程中,需要考虑刀具的选择、加工路径的规划、切削参数的设置等因素。

    4. 数控编程的应用领域:数控编程广泛应用于机械加工行业,包括铣削、车削、钻孔、镗削、切割等各种加工方式。它能够实现对工件进行高精度、高效率的加工,广泛应用于航空航天、汽车制造、模具制造、电子设备制造等领域。

    5. 数控编程的优势和挑战:数控编程可以提高加工精度和效率,降低人工操作的错误率和劳动强度,同时还可以实现复杂形状的加工和灵活的加工路径规划。然而,数控编程也需要具备专业的技术知识和经验,以及良好的分析和解决问题的能力。此外,数控编程还需要不断更新和学习新的编程技术和工艺,以适应快速发展的制造业的需求。

    总而言之,数控编程是一种将产品设计和工程图纸转化为可执行指令的技术,它广泛应用于机械加工行业,能够实现精确、高效的加工操作。掌握数控编程需要具备专业的知识和技能,并面对一系列的挑战和需求。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    数控编程(AO)是一种通过编写程序来控制数控机床进行加工的过程。它是将设计者的想法转化为机床可以理解和执行的指令的一种方法。

    数控编程(Computer Numerical Control Programming) 是一种用于生成机床加工路径的计算机程序。AO程序是由一系列指令组成的,这些指令告诉数控机床如何进行切削、定位、进给和其他操作。AO程序可以通过手动编写、自动化生成或使用CAD/CAM软件生成。

    数控编程的步骤通常包括以下几个方面:

    1. 零件设计:首先需要进行零件的设计。可以使用CAD软件进行3D建模或2D绘图,设计出所需的形状和尺寸。

    2. 选择机床:根据工件的特性和加工要求选择合适的数控机床。不同的机床可能具有不同的功能和加工能力。

    3. 刀具选择:根据加工要求选择合适的刀具。刀具的类型、尺寸和材质等都会影响加工的质量和效率。

    4. 刀具路径规划:根据零件的几何形状和切削要求,规划刀具的路径。这包括切削方向、切削深度、切削速度和进给速度等参数的确定。

    5. 编写AO程序:根据刀具路径规划,编写AO程序。AO程序通常采用一种称为G代码的语言来描述切削操作。G代码包括十几个预定义的指令,用于控制数控机床的各个功能。

    6. 程序验证:在进行实际加工之前,需要先对编写的AO程序进行验证。可以通过模拟器或虚拟机床来模拟加工过程,检查刀具路径是否正确,避免碰撞和其他错误。

    7. 上传程序:将验证通过的AO程序上传到数控机床的控制系统中。可以通过U盘、网络上传或直接通过电脑连接数控机床进行传输。

    8. 加工调试:在加工前,需要对数控机床进行调试,确保各个轴线的运动正常,刀具路径和加工参数设置正确。

    9. 加工实施:经过上述准备工作后,就可以进行实际的加工。数控机床会按照AO程序中的指令进行切削、定位和进给等操作,将零件加工出来。

    10. 质量检查:加工完成后,需要对加工出来的零件进行质量检查。可以使用测量仪器测量尺寸和形状等参数,与设计要求进行对比。

    总结:数控编程是一种将设计者的想法转化为机床操作指令的过程。它需要经过零件设计、机床选择、刀具选择、刀具路径规划、AO程序编写、程序验证、上传程序、加工调试、加工实施和质量检查等多个步骤。通过数控编程,可以实现高效、精确和重复性良好的零件加工。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部